Automatic negotiation of an internet protocol address for a network connected device
First Claim
1. A method of communicating with a shared imaging apparatus connected to a computer network, wherein communication over said network is facilitated through use of network packets, said method comprising the steps of:
- providing said shared imaging apparatus with networking hardware;
providing said shared imaging apparatus with imaging apparatus firmware;
defining a data channel associated with said networking hardware;
instructing said networking hardware to accept information on said data channel from a user that owns said data channel;
processing automatic Internet Protocol (IP) address negotiation network packets with said imaging apparatus firmware when said data channel is not owned; and
processing second types of network packets, different from said automatic IP address negotiation network packets, by said networking hardware of said shared imaging apparatus when said data channel is owned, wherein when said data channel is not owned, then determining whether to place said shared imaging apparatus in an automatic IP address negotiation state, and if said shared imaging apparatus is placed in said automatic IP address negotiation state, then attempting to automatically assign an IP address to said shared imaging apparatus.
3 Assignments
0 Petitions
Accused Products
Abstract
A method of communicating with a shared imaging apparatus connected to a computer network, wherein communication over the network is facilitated through use of network packets, includes the steps of providing the shared imaging apparatus with networking hardware; providing the shared imaging apparatus with imaging apparatus firmware; defining a data channel associated with the networking hardware; instructing the networking hardware to accept information on the data channel from a user that owns the data channel; processing automatic Internet Protocol (IP) address negotiation network packets with the imaging apparatus firmware when the data channel is not owned; and processing second types of network packets, different from the automatic IP address negotiation network packets, by the networking hardware of the shared imaging apparatus when the data channel is owned.
33 Citations
33 Claims
-
1. A method of communicating with a shared imaging apparatus connected to a computer network, wherein communication over said network is facilitated through use of network packets, said method comprising the steps of:
-
providing said shared imaging apparatus with networking hardware; providing said shared imaging apparatus with imaging apparatus firmware; defining a data channel associated with said networking hardware; instructing said networking hardware to accept information on said data channel from a user that owns said data channel; processing automatic Internet Protocol (IP) address negotiation network packets with said imaging apparatus firmware when said data channel is not owned; and processing second types of network packets, different from said automatic IP address negotiation network packets, by said networking hardware of said shared imaging apparatus when said data channel is owned, wherein when said data channel is not owned, then determining whether to place said shared imaging apparatus in an automatic IP address negotiation state, and if said shared imaging apparatus is placed in said automatic IP address negotiation state, then attempting to automatically assign an IP address to said shared imaging apparatus.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A method of communicating with a shared imaging apparatus connected to a computer network, wherein communication over said network is facilitated through use of network packets, said method comprising the steps of:
-
providing said shared imaging apparatus with networking hardware; providing said shared imaging apparatus with imaging apparatus firmware; defining a data channel associated with said networking hardware; instructing said networking hardware to accept information on said data channel from a user that owns said data channel; processing automatic Internet Protocol (IP) address negotiation network packets with said imaging apparatus firmware when said data channel is not owned; and processing second types of network packets, different from said automatic IP address negotiation network packets, by said networking hardware of said shared imaging apparatus when said data channel is owned, wherein when said data channel is not owned, then determining whether to place said shared imaging apparatus in an automatic Internet Protocol (IP) address negotiation state, and if said shared imaging apparatus is placed in said automatic IP address negotiation state, then attempting to automatically renew a current IP address for said shared imaging apparatus.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A method of communicating with a shared imaging apparatus connected to a computer network, wherein communication ova said network is facilitated through use of network packets, said method comprising the steps of:
-
providing said shared imaging apparatus with networking hardware; providing said shared imaging apparatus with imaging apparatus firmware; defining a data channel associated with said networking hardware; instructing said networking hardware to accept information on said data channel from a user that owns said data channel; processing automatic Internet Protocol (IP) address negotiation network packets with said imaging apparatus firmware when said data channel is not owned; and processing second types of network packets, different from said automatic IP address negotiation network packets, by said networking hardware of said shared imaging apparatus when said data channel is owned, wherein when said shared imaging apparatus is in an idle state, then determining whether to place said shred imaging apparatus in an automatic Internet Protocol (IP) address negotiation state, and if said shared imaging apparatus is placed in said automatic IP address negotiation state, then attempting to automatically assign an IP address for said shared imaging apparatus. - View Dependent Claims (24, 25, 26, 27, 28, 29, 30, 31, 32, 33)
-
Specification